Ingredients:
1 lb ground beef
6 slices cooked bacon, crumbled
2 cups cooked macaroni and cheese
4 large tortillas
1 cup shredded cheddar cheese
1/4 cup BBQ sauce (optional)
1 tablespoon mustard
Salt and pepper to taste
Instructions:
Cook the Beef: In a skillet over medium heat, cook the ground beef until browned, seasoning with salt and pepper. Drain any excess grease, then stir in the mustard and BBQ sauce if you prefer a smoky, tangy flavor.
Prepare the Wraps: Lay the tortillas out flat and spread a generous portion of creamy macaroni and cheese in the center of each one.
Layer the Beef and Bacon: On top of the mac and cheese, add the cooked ground beef, followed by crumbled bacon and shredded cheddar cheese.
Wrap It Up: Fold in the sides of each tortilla and roll it up tightly, burrito-style.
Grill to Perfection: Heat a skillet over medium heat. Place the wraps seam-side down and grill for 2-3 minutes per side until the tortillas are crispy and golden, and the cheese has melted inside.
Serve & Enjoy: Slice in half and serve with extra BBQ sauce, mustard, or your favorite dipping sauce for an added kick!
Recipe Variations & Tips
Vegetarian Option: Substitute the ground beef with plant-based crumbles or sautéed mushrooms.
Low-Carb: Use low-carb tortillas or swap the mac and cheese for cauliflower rice.
Spicy Kick: Add a drizzle of hot sauce or jalapeños for an extra punch of heat.
Side Dishes: Serve with a side of crispy fries, a fresh green salad, or even a tangy coleslaw to balance out the rich flavors of the wrap.
